Nursing
diagnosis
Risk for infection (00004) evidenced by inadequate primary defenses (immature immune system, broken skin/
open surgical wound and altered peristalsis), inadequate secondary defenses (decreased hemoglobin), increased
environmental exposure to pathogens, multiple invasive procedures
Nursing
interventions
Infection control (6540)
Infection protection (6550)
Nursing
activities
Do the observance of universal precautions
Ensure appropriate wound care technique
Monitor for systemic and localized signs and symptoms
of infection
Inspect condition of any surgical incision/wound
Ensure aseptic handling of all IV lines
Obtain cultures, as needed
Monitor absolute granulocyte count, WBC count, and
differential results
